Neptune Opposite Eros: Projection & Fantasies

Published September 11, 2024

Neptune opposite Eros puts illusions and desires at odds. This can be a complex aspect that blurs boundaries and causes disillusionment about relationships and connections with others.

Unrealistic fantasies and projecting desires onto partners are common with this opposition. Balance is needed for authentic expression and connection.

What does Neptune opposite Eros mean? This opposition creates tension between Neptune’s fantasies and Eros’ desire for connection. It can make it difficult to discern romantic dreams from reality.

Individuals may idealize partners and form connections with others based on illusions. They might be confused about their true desires or become disillusioned when others don’t live up to their unrealistic expectations.

Couples will struggle to bond authentically because their minds and hearts are clouded. Grounding and connecting to reality, even when forming romantic connections, is essential to balance this opposition.

Natal

Neptune opposite Eros in a chart can make it difficult for someone to navigate the difference between unrealistic dreams and genuine, attainable desires in their relationships and connections with others.

People with this aspect in their chart often project their desires onto others. If they want a certain type of partner or a specific bond with them, they may convince themselves the other person also wants the same things they do.

If you have Neptune opposite Eros in your Natal Chart, your perception of your connections with others and the reality of those connections might be at odds. Your fantasies will influence how you see your relationships.

You might want a deep, meaningful bond with someone so badly that you deceive yourself into believing you already have that bond. You will then become confused when that person doesn’t return your feelings or doesn’t act the way you think they should.

You can become disillusioned about relationships if you continuously project unrealistic fantasies onto others. You may become depressed or frustrated when reality comes crashing in on you, creating further conflict in your relationships.

Neptune’s illusions will cloud your ability to see relationships as they truly are. It can also make it difficult for you to connect to your desires and do what it takes to form lasting connections with others.

You must be more discerning and ground yourself to balance this opposition. Ask yourself what you truly want from a relationship and if your desires are realistic. If not, examine why you desire them in the first place.

You can have meaningful and loving relationships. You can fulfill your desires and bond with others emotionally, spiritually, and physically. You have to learn how to stop idealizing and projecting onto other people.

Transit

Neptune opposite Eros during a transit can make it difficult to sort fantasies from reality when trying to connect to others.

If Neptune transits your natal Eros, you might pursue a connection with someone who isn’t right for you. You may convince yourself that they are, though. You will be more likely to project your desires onto others, regardless of their desires or who they truly are.

If Eros transits your natal Neptune, you may develop unrealistic expectations for your relationships. If you have a partner, you will have trouble separating your desires from the realities of your relationship.

The Neptune-Eros opposition can show you how your fantasies and desires don’t match your genuine connections with those in your life. It can disrupt your relationships if you give in to fantasies and illusions, too.

You are more likely to make assumptions about how others feel during this time. You may assume a partner is more committed to you than they are. You might think you are establishing a strong connection with someone who is not interested in you.

If you let your imagination get the best of you during this time, it will fuel your desires and make you believe someone is fulfilling them when they aren’t. It can also stop you from seeing the true desires of those around you.

You must ground yourself and face reality to find balance during this time. Don’t focus on what you want. Focus on what is happening.

No matter how much you fantasize about it, you can’t force a connection that isn’t there. Someone who is unavailable or disinterested cannot fulfill your desires or give you the love you need.

Synastry

Neptune opposite Eros in synastry creates tension between one partner’s fantasies and the other’s desires. This couple may want a strong emotional connection, but they may have certain illusions or unrealistic expectations that hold them back.

The Neptune partner in this relationship sometimes projects their desires onto the Eros partner. They might have a specific dream of what a relationship looks like but will be disappointed when reality doesn’t match their fantasies.

The Eros partner in this relationship will have desires that won’t match the Neptune partner’s. They might become passionate and intense in this relationship, which will be attractive to the Neptune partner but can also clash with Neptune’s unstable nature.

Both partners may bring certain expectations into this relationship. They may have an intense, almost fantastical connection right from the start. That doesn’t mean this connection is authentic or entirely based in reality.

This couple can get lost in one another in the worst possible ways. The potential for this couple to lose themselves in a fantasy is one of the Neptune opposite Eros cons.

Sometimes, the Eros partner’s desire for connection will cause them to try to fulfill unrealistic desires. The Neptune partner’s fantasies will prevent them from connecting to the Eros partner.

This couple must ground themselves. These two must communicate openly and honestly about their desires and speak up if those desires don’t match or if certain ones are unrealistic.

When this couple finds balance and is more realistic, they can form a genuine connection, which is one of the Neptune opposite Eros pros. They can bond spiritually, emotionally, and physically.

This relationship can be passionate and romantic. Each partner can have what they desire if their desires are realistic and attainable. They don’t have to sacrifice what they want or who they are. They have to be realistic.

Composite

Neptune opposite Eros in a Composite Chart can create a complicated dynamic between two people who cannot distinguish genuine, attainable desires from fantasies and illusions.

This couple will likely lose themselves in an overly romanticized version of love. They might idealize their relationship and ignore its faults, which won’t benefit them in the long run.

Each partner may put the other on a pedestal or project their desires onto them. They sometimes don’t fall in love with each other because of who they are. They fall in love because of who they imagine one another to be.

One partner may think the other can fulfill all their desires and fantasies and will expect them to do so. They will both become disillusioned when they can’t meet each other’s expectations or fulfill specific desires, no matter how unrealistic.

This couple is looking for the perfect relationship, but no relationship is perfect. Certain parts of their connection might come more easily than others, but that doesn’t mean things will always be smooth sailing.

Each partner needs to examine their desires. They need to reflect on the expectations they have for one another. They must ask themselves if these things are realistic or if they need to make some adjustments and ground themselves.

This couple can have a passionate and romantic bond but must connect to reality. They must have attainable expectations. They should share realistic desires, not mere fantasies.

Certain aspects of this relationship can be transcendent, spiritual, and mystical. However, this couple still has responsibilities and needs to work to form a solid bond. They can’t just expect everything to come to them easily.

When these two are grounded, their relationship will be better. They can love each other’s true selves rather than loving a fantasy.

Solar Return

Neptune opposite Eros during a solar return typically indicates that you must explore the boundaries between your fantasies about relationships and the reality of your relationships with others.

The year following this solar return is a great time to connect to your desires and examine them. Ask yourself if anyone is meeting your desires. If they are not, what is getting in the way?

Sometimes, you are the one preventing your desires from being fulfilled. You might be looking for the “perfect” partner, only to be disappointed when they don’t exist.

Reflect on your relationship expectations as well. What do you want and need from a partner? Are these things attainable? If not, how can you adjust your expectations so that somebody can meet them?

You do not need to give up on all your desires in the upcoming year, but you do have to be realistic. Certain fantasies are only ever going to be fantasies, and you must accept that and try to focus on realistic desires.

If you find that your current relationship is unfulfilling, don’t ignore that. If you try to force a connection or pretend everything is fine, you can’t fix anything. Be willing to address your issues with your partner. Dealing with conflict may help you form a stronger, healthier connection.

Even if things don’t work out with your partner, or you spend this entire year single and never find the person you’re looking for, that’s okay. You can learn valuable lessons about yourself regardless.

You could end this year with a better grip on the reality of your desires. You can learn to connect to others in tangible and real ways rather than relying entirely on fantasies.
